#c07698 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c07698 is composed of 75.3% red, 46.3%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 332.4 degrees, a saturation of 37% and a lightness of 60.8%. #c07698 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#810031.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#c07698 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c07698 has RGB values of R:192, G:118,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.21,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12613272.

Shades and Tints of #c07698
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0508 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c07698
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1959a is the less saturated color, while #fe3893 is the most saturated one.
